Output d17d7bfdbb783514894e24a31287436686bbde7a0742a4930993e0b57357d01a:0

value
2058576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 233fe68df6591a2d5b5a09475297255014d97a62 OP_EQUAL
address
34uQ89dW4eMYcX1h3zKRDiiAMBGz1TbsjB
transaction
d17d7bfdbb783514894e24a31287436686bbde7a0742a4930993e0b57357d01a
spent
true